TAYLOR, Presiding Judge.
The appellant, Timothy Dale Leatherman, was convicted of robbery in the first degree, a violation of § 13A-8-41, Code of Alabama 1975. He was sentenced to life imprisonment. The appellant presents two issues on appeal.
I
The appellant first contends that his statement to police should have been suppressed because, he says, he had requested an attorney before he made the statement and one was not supplied. The evidence...
